Output 68118318dd0148328f64e996fc2e2027340e5adf77289f076a9978cf70ab8453:0

value
18642063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 160b28ac8b959fbabc1b23f4f25d3a1842751032 OP_EQUALVERIFY OP_CHECKSIG
address
131ZEZ5RumpjidBuropX71H2d9xh7jxNF2
transaction
68118318dd0148328f64e996fc2e2027340e5adf77289f076a9978cf70ab8453
confirmations
369364
spent
true